New Nook Glowlight 4?

The long and the short of it:
  • 6" screen
  • Similar design to the Glowlight 3 (page turn buttons on both sides)
  • Smaller design (almost an inch shorter and a quarter of an inch narrower than the 3)
  • Faster processor, so it's faster overall
  • Eink Carta 1200 (I think it's the only 6" device using one so far?)
  • Not waterproof
  • Pretty much the same Nook firmware
